The Increasing Demand for RV Storage Solutions

The first trend to consider is the rising number of RV owners. As more people choose this lifestyle, the need for RV storage near me options grows. Many city dwellers find it challenging to store their RVs on their property due to space constraints or local regulations. This has created an upsurge in the number of dedicated RV storage facilities.

With more people investing in RVs, the storage facilities will likely diversify. From open-air lots to fully enclosed storage units featuring climate control, RV storage options are expanding to accommodate the various needs of RV owners. Owners of campers and larger custom RVs can find tailored solutions to suit their specific requirements.

Smart Technology in RV Storage

Technology is playing a vital role in shaping the future of RV storage. One major trend is the integration of smart technology in storage facilities. Many RV storage providers are beginning to implement smart locks, surveillance systems, and automated access controls to enhance security and convenience.

Key Features of Smart RV Storage Systems

  • Remote Monitoring: Many facilities now offer apps to help RV owners monitor their vehicles from anywhere.
  • Smart Access: Keyless entry systems enable quick access to storage units without the hassle of physical keys.
  • Real-Time Security Alerts: Security cameras send alerts directly to owners’ smartphones in case of unusual activity.
  • Online Reservations: Users can book their storage space online, making it easier to find RV storage close to me.

The move toward smart technology not only improves safety but also saves time for RV owners seeking convenience in their storage solutions.

Sustainability in RV Storage

As the world increasingly focuses on sustainability, RV storage facilities are also adapting. Green practices are becoming standard in the industry. Today’s RV owners are more conscious about their environmental impact, leading to a demand for eco-friendly storage options.

Innovative Green Storage Practices

  • Solar-Powered Facilities: Some RV storage locations are turning to solar panels to power their premises, which can offset energy costs and reduce carbon footprints.
  • Eco-Friendly Materials: Facilities are using sustainable materials for construction and landscaping, focusing on minimizing environmental impact.
  • Organic Pest Control: Instead of chemicals, storage facilities are employing organic pest control methods to maintain cleanliness and safety for stored campers and RVs.

This trend not only appeals to eco-conscious RV owners but also helps storage facilities reduce operational costs in the long run.

Flexible Storage Options

The traditional model of RV storage often requires a long-term commitment. However, owners are seeking more flexible options that fit their dynamic lifestyles. Many facilities are beginning to offer RV storage with short-term and seasonal rates, along with customizable plans to suit individual needs.

Types of Flexible Storage Plans

  • Seasonal Storage: Ideal for those who only use their RVs during certain months, this option allows for savings during the off-season.
  • Month-to-Month Agreements: Perfect for owners who might be relocating or uncertain about their future plans.
  • Combination Packages: Many facilities are creating options that provide storage along with maintenance services for added convenience.

These flexible arrangements ensure that owning an RV remains convenient and cost-effective, catering to diverse lifestyles.

Enhanced Security Measures

Security has always been a primary concern for RV owners who place significant investments in their vehicles. The future of RV storage is heading towards even more sophisticated security solutions to provide peace of mind that your camper or RV is safe.

Advances in Security Infrastructure

  • Gated Access: New RV storage facilities are increasingly using gated entries with security codes to restrict access to only authorized users.
  • 24/7 Surveillance: Continuous video monitoring helps ensure that any potential security breaches are captured quickly.
  • On-Site Security Personnel: Many places are now employing on-site guards to enhance safety throughout the day and night.

With these advancements, RV owners can feel assured that their vehicles are being closely watched and protected.
